- CHANGE: Law allowing tubal ligation without spouse's approval is sanctioned. The new rule also includes the reduction from 25 to 21 years of the minimum age allowed to carry out the sterilization procedure. (Folha de S. Paulo)
- ELECTIONS: Bolsonaro drops 2 points in voting intentions, according to a new survey by BTG Pactual: from 36% to 34%. Lula still leads with 42%, but has also dropped 1 point compared to the last survey. (Metropolises)
- UK: Liz Truss is elected new Prime Minister of the United Kingdom. After Boris Johnson's departure, Margaret Thatcher's admirer assumes one of the highest positions in the British government. Liz is the third woman to hold the position in history. (G1)
- BURNED: In 3 days, the Amazon recorded half of the fires of September 2021. 8.740 hot spots were identified, according to the National Institute for Space Research (Inpe). (UOL)
- EMMY: The awards for the 74th edition of the Emmys have already begun. Last weekend the technical categories were awarded. Stranger Things, Round 6 and Euphoria were some of the winners. The official ceremony takes place on September 12th. (Rolling Stone)
